Ive just moved and have to give up broadband for trusty old 56k dial-up so Im looking for a decent unmetered access provider that provides a reasonable monthly limit and a realistic contention ratio, anyone recommend an ISP?

I wouldn't recomend Tesco's.
It's reasonably cheap, (£13pm), but it knocks u off every 2 hours , comes with it's own dialer that you can only minimize onto the task bar (ie doesn't dissappear), and doesn't reconnect automatically after it's thrown you out.
Oh and when you connect, it insists on diverting the first open IE windows to tesco.com [img]images/smilies/mad.gif[/img]
